Chlorinated Isocyanurates Market Outlook
The global chlorinated isocyanurates market was valued at approximately USD 4.5 billion in 2023 and is projected to reach USD 6.8 billion by 2035, growing at a compound annual growth rate (CAGR) of around 5.5% during the forecast period. This growth can be attributed to the increasing demand for water treatment solutions, the rising awareness regarding hygiene and sanitation, and the growing agricultural sector that relies on disinfectants and sanitizers. Further driving factors include the expansion of industrial applications requiring effective chemical sanitization, along with a global push for sustainable and environmentally friendly water treatment methods. The chlorinated isocyanurates market is seeing significant innovations, including enhanced formulations aimed at improving efficacy and safety, which cater to a diverse range of end-users.

By Product Type
Powder:
The powder segment of chlorinated isocyanurates is anticipated to hold a significant share of the market, primarily due to its versatility and high efficacy in various applications. Powdered forms are preferred in water treatment processes, as they provide a concentrated solution that is easy to handle and store. Additionally, the ease of transportation and storage benefits powder products, making them a favorite for both industrial and agricultural uses. The capability of powdered chlorinated isocyanurates to dissolve quickly in water enhances their effectiveness in disinfection and sanitation tasks. This segment is also witnessing continual innovations aimed at enhancing solubility and reducing environmental impact, positioning it as a frontrunner in the chlorinated isocyanurates market.
Granules:
The granules segment of chlorinated isocyanurates is gaining momentum in the market, being widely utilized in agricultural applications and water treatment processes. Granular formulations offer advantages in terms of controlled release, making them ideal for long-term applications such as pool sanitation and agricultural soil treatment. Their ease of application and effectiveness in providing a steady source of chlorine contributes to their growing popularity among users. Furthermore, the granular form reduces the risk of chlorine release into the environment during handling, making it a more environmentally friendly option. As regulations on chemical usage tighten, the demand for safer and more manageable forms like granules is expected to increase.
Tablets:
The tablets segment is becoming increasingly popular due to their convenience and safety in handling. Chlorinated isocyanurate tablets are designed for controlled release, allowing for a steady supply of disinfectant over time, making them particularly useful in small-scale water treatment applications and household disinfecting products. Their compact nature makes them easy to store and transport, which is a significant advantage for both consumers and manufacturers. Additionally, tablets offer precise dosage control, which is essential for both effectiveness and safety. The growth of this segment is supported by rising consumer preferences for easy-to-use products that do not compromise on effectiveness.
Liquid:
The liquid form of chlorinated isocyanurates is witnessing growth due to its ease of application and immediate effectiveness in disinfection applications. Liquid products are particularly favored in scenarios requiring rapid deployment, such as emergency disinfection or immediate water treatment needs. They are commonly used in commercial settings, including restaurants and healthcare facilities, where high hygiene standards are a must. The liquid form also allows for versatility in various applications, from surface disinfection to agricultural uses. As industries continually seek effective solutions for rapid sanitation, the liquid segment is projected to grow steadily, catering to an increasingly diverse range of end-users.
By Application
Water Treatment:
The water treatment application segment stands as one of the largest consumer sectors for chlorinated isocyanurates, driven primarily by the global need for safe drinking water. With urbanization and population growth leading to increased water demand, the need for effective water treatment solutions has surged. Chlorinated isocyanurates are preferred due to their efficiency in eliminating pathogens and maintaining water quality over time. Furthermore, regulatory standards regarding water safety continue to tighten, pushing municipalities and industries to invest in reliable disinfectants. This trend is expected to sustain the growth of chlorinated isocyanurates in water treatment applications over the coming years.
Disinfectants:
The disinfectant application segment is rapidly expanding as both commercial and residential sectors prioritize hygiene and sanitation. The COVID-19 pandemic has significantly propelled the demand for effective disinfectants, making chlorinated isocyanurates a popular choice due to their broad-spectrum antimicrobial activity. These compounds are increasingly utilized in the production of surface cleaners, sanitizers, and wipes. The versatility of chlorinated isocyanurates in addressing various microbial threats ensures they remain a staple in the fight against infections. As public awareness around sanitation continues to grow, so too will the use of chlorinated isocyanurates in disinfectant applications.
Industrial Processes:
Chlorinated isocyanurates find extensive use in various industrial processes, where their properties as a bleaching agent and disinfectant are invaluable. Industries such as textiles, paper, and food processing leverage these compounds for sanitation, disinfection, and maintenance of hygiene standards. Their ability to act under various conditions makes them an essential component in manufacturing processes that require strict adherence to cleanliness. Moreover, as industries strive for sustainability, there is a growing trend towards utilizing chlorine-based disinfectants that are effective yet environmentally friendly. This has led to increased adoption of chlorinated isocyanurates across diverse industrial applications.
Agriculture:
In the agriculture sector, chlorinated isocyanurates are being increasingly used for crop protection and sanitation purposes. They play a crucial role in preventing bacterial and fungal infections in crops, thereby enhancing yield quality and productivity. As farmers seek effective methods to safeguard their produce against various pathogens, the demand for chlorinated isocyanurates as biocides and fungicides is on the rise. Additionally, the need for sustainable agricultural practices is driving the adoption of such agrochemicals that provide effective control with minimal environmental impact. With the rising global population and the demand for higher food production, the agricultural application of chlorinated isocyanurates is expected to expand significantly.
Others:
The 'Others' application segment encompasses a range of uses for chlorinated isocyanurates that do not neatly fit into the primary categories of water treatment, disinfectants, industrial processes, or agriculture. This can include niche applications such as swimming pool sanitation, veterinary medicine, and specific cleaning protocols in various organizations. As unique applications evolve, the versatility of chlorinated isocyanurates positions them as a valuable resource across multiple sectors. Moreover, continuous research and development efforts are likely to unveil new applications and improve the efficacy of existing uses, further driving growth in this segment.

By Region
The regional analysis of the chlorinated isocyanurates market reveals diverse growth patterns, with North America being a prominent player, accounting for approximately 30% of the global market share. The increasing focus on water safety and sanitation has led to heightened demand for effective water treatment solutions in this region. Furthermore, stringent regulations regarding water quality and environmental safety continue to drive the adoption of chlorinated isocyanurates. The North American market is projected to grow at a CAGR of 5.2% through 2035, reflecting an ongoing commitment to improving public health standards and maintaining quality in industrial processes.
Europe is another significant market for chlorinated isocyanurates, contributing nearly 25% to the total market share. The region's robust industrial base, coupled with rising consumer awareness about hygiene and sanitation, bolsters the demand for chlorinated isocyanurates across various applications, including disinfectants and water treatment. The European market is expected to experience a steady growth rate, supported by innovative product developments and increased investments in sustainable chemical solutions. Additionally, the Asia Pacific region is witnessing rapid growth, driven by industrialization and urbanization, which necessitate improved sanitation and hygienic practices.

Threats
One of the primary threats facing the chlorinated isocyanurates market is the increasing competition from alternative disinfection and sanitization products. As industries seek more sustainable and eco-friendly solutions, some manufacturers are developing non-chlorinated compounds that can effectively replace traditional chlorinated disinfectants. This shift could pose a significant challenge to the chlorinated isocyanurates market, particularly if consumer preferences continue to trend towards greener products. Additionally, regulatory pressures regarding chemical safety and environmental impact are intensifying, which may result in stricter guidelines and compliance requirements impacting production processes and market access.
Another noteworthy challenge is the potential for adverse health effects associated with chlorinated compounds. Growing awareness regarding the health implications of using chlorine-based disinfectants may lead to skepticism among consumers and businesses alike. This concern can hinder the market's growth, especially if negative perceptions regarding safety persist.
